MARYVILLE, Mo. -
Emma Wright hit her first career home run to make the difference in a 2-1 win at Northwest Missouri in the opener of a doubleheader and then the Mavericks had eight hits in an 11-1 win in the night cap as they swept the Bearcats Tuesday afternoon.
No. 22 Nebraska-Omaha improved to 28-7 and 4-2 in the MIAA and will return home to host Upper Iowa Wednesday at 3 p.m. at Claussen-Westgate Field.
Wright drove in
Chelsea Koch, who singled up the middle, with a home run to left center in the second inning of game one. It was her first long ball of the year and just her third hit in her freshman season. That was UNO's only offense of the game but it was enough as
Melissa Negrete pitched a four-hit complete game. She allowed four hits and struck out eight.
The Bearcats scored their run in the bottom of the seventh when Negrete gave up a pair of two-out doubles but she got the final batter to line out to second to end the game.
In the second game
Amanda Bader hit a three-run homer in the first and
Treightin Yates had a three-run shot in the third. The Mavs also added two runs in the fifth when Koch doubled and Wright walked and they both later scored on a double to left field by
Ashley Lynch.
Koch was 3 for 3 in the game and Bader was 2 for 3 with the three RBI.
Lindsey Slocum pitched the entire game and remained perfect on the year with an 8-0 record. She allowed one run off five hits with three strikeouts and no walks.
